Rhea-AI Filing Summary

TENAX THERAPEUTICS, INC. (TENX) received a Schedule 13G reporting a significant ownership position by Millennium Management LLC, Millennium Group Management LLC, and Israel A. Englander. These reporting persons disclose beneficial ownership of 2,156,891 shares of Tenax Therapeutics common stock, representing 5.8% of the outstanding class. They report no sole voting or dispositive power over the shares, but shared voting and shared dispositive power over the same 2,156,891 shares. The shares are held by entities subject to voting control and investment discretion by Millennium Management LLC and/or other investment managers that may be controlled by Millennium Group Management LLC and Mr. Englander. The filing states that this structure should not, by itself, be construed as an admission by any of the reporting persons of beneficial ownership of the securities held by those entities.

Schedule 13G regulatory
"received a Schedule 13G reporting a significant ownership position"
A Schedule 13G is a formal document that investors file with the government when they acquire a large ownership stake in a company, usually for investment purposes rather than control. It helps keep the public informed about who owns significant parts of a company's shares, which can influence how the company is managed and how investors make decisions. Filing this schedule is important for transparency and understanding the ownership landscape of publicly traded companies.
beneficially owned financial
"Amount beneficially owned: See response to Item 9 on each cover page"
Beneficially owned describes securities or assets where a person has the economic rights and control—such as the right to receive dividends and to direct voting—even if legal title is held in another name. Think of it like having the keys and using a car that’s registered to someone else: you get the benefits and make decisions. Investors care because beneficial ownership reveals who truly controls value and voting power, affecting corporate decisions and takeover dynamics.
shared voting power financial
"Shared Voting Power 2,156,891.00"
Shared voting power occurs when two or more parties jointly have the right to vote or decide how a block of company shares is cast, like co-owners who must agree before moving a piece of furniture. Investors care because who controls voting rights affects board elections, major corporate decisions and takeover outcomes, and shared control can alter regulatory disclosures and the practical influence any holder has over a company’s direction and value.
